hie friends,
I have recently upgraded my computer system from Windows XP to Windows Vista. Here, the notification area balloons frequently popsup which is really annoying.
How do I turnoff them in Vista? ...... can someone help me with this
thanx
You can do this by using registry editor method.
- Click Start --- Run --- type Regedit.exe
- Navigate to the following subkey:
HKEY_CURRENT_USER \ Software \ Microsoft \ Windows \ CurrentVersion \ Explorer \ Advanced- Create a new REG_DWORD (32 bit) value named EnableBalloonTips
- Double-click EnableBalloonTips, and then assign a value data of 0
- Exit the Registry Editor
- Log off Windows, and then log back on.
This applies to both Windows Vista as well as Windows XP
Alternate method -
- Start and type GPEDIT.MSC
- Accept the User Account Control prompt
- Navigate to the following branch:
User Configuration \ Administrative Templates \ Start Menu and Taskbar
- Double-click Turn off all balloon notifications and set it to Enabled
- Close Group Policy Editor
- Log off Windows, and then log back on.
Here is the corresponding registry value for the above setting:
HKEY_CURRENT_USER \ Software \ Microsoft \ Windows \ CurrentVersion \ Policies \ Explorer
"TaskbarNoNotification"=dword:00000001
There is a way to completely turn off task bar balloon notifications using a registry edit hack.
To do this, start the registry editor and navigate to this section:
HKEY_CURRENT_USER> Software > Microsoft > Windows > CurrentVersion > Explorer Advanced
- Once you get there right-click on an empty area of the right side of the window and select New > 32-bit DWORD. Give the new entry the name EnableBalloonTips and a value of 0.
- Once you are done, you'll need to reboot for the change to take effect. But once you do, the task bar balloon notifications will be completely turned off.
